Transaction 2f62b59aa4591d826432f40631417888892f14cca828de5fb433e0a771dcd378

1 Input
2 Outputs
  • 2f62b59aa4591d826432f40631417888892f14cca828de5fb433e0a771dcd378:0
  • value  760860
    address  37Q71Az33kS1Qb9PYZVoGXjcer7uYtd2WU
  • 2f62b59aa4591d826432f40631417888892f14cca828de5fb433e0a771dcd378:1
  • value  91261268
    address  3FSZKrhE2NVNRR3YsB7xFNxssVHPTZmM87